 At Wangfujing and Qianmen there is a feeling of the local history even with a door created almost in the style associated with the nearby Forbidden City. Other murals depict traditional courtyard homes. Yongdingmenwai also on Line 8 reflects the important of the nearby entrance through the former Outer City Walls. Indeed also its position at the southern end of Beijing’s unique, historic axis line. There is a compact, quite attractive art gallery displaying items reflecting scenes around the Gate in years now long past gone. Some stations are now featuring a convenience store, which is surely a welcome, useful addition, aimed at improving passenger satisfaction.
